
Steadview Capital
Description
Steadview Capital is a prominent global investment firm with a strong focus on technology and technology-enabled businesses. Headquartered in London, the firm is known for its long-term, patient capital approach, primarily targeting growth-stage companies across various geographies, including India, Southeast Asia, and the United States. Steadview typically acts as a lead or co-lead investor in significant funding rounds, providing substantial capital to support the scaling and expansion of its portfolio companies. Its investment philosophy emphasizes partnering with strong management teams in sectors poised for significant disruption and growth.
The firm's investment strategy is characterized by its sector-agnostic yet tech-centric approach, covering areas such as fintech, e-commerce, software-as-a-service (SaaS), and consumer internet. Steadview seeks out businesses with proven unit economics, large addressable markets, and clear paths to profitability. They are known for their deep due diligence and a hands-on approach post-investment, offering strategic guidance to help companies navigate complex growth challenges. This strategic engagement, combined with significant capital injections, positions Steadview as a preferred partner for ambitious tech ventures.
Steadview Capital has demonstrated substantial financial capacity through its successive fundraises. For instance, the firm successfully raised over $1.5 billion for its fourth fund, Steadview Capital IV, in 2021, underscoring its ability to deploy significant capital into high-growth opportunities. This substantial funding pool allows Steadview to make sizable investments, often ranging from tens to hundreds of millions of dollars per transaction. With reported assets under management (AUM) exceeding $5 billion, Steadview Capital maintains a robust financial position, enabling it to participate in some of the largest and most competitive growth equity rounds globally.
Investor Profile
Steadview Capital has backed more than 78 startups, with 3 new investments in the last 12 months alone. The firm has led 29 rounds, about 37% of its total and boasts 10 exits across its portfolio.
Investment Focus Highlights
- Concentrates on Series D, Series C, Series B rounds (top funding stages).
- Majority of deals are located in India, United States, Bahamas.
- Strong thematic focus on E-Commerce, Financial Services, SaaS.
- Typical check size: $25M – $200M.
